- I had trouble initially printing Finale output on our postscript
- printers. We have a Tektronix Phaser III and a SPARC Printer. Neither
- would print the output correctly.
-
- However, when we upgraded our SPARC Printer from NeWSPrint 1.0 to 2.0
- it worked! Looks great too!
-
- The PostScript output from Finale includes the music fonts. This
- requires some new level of PostScript which allows the embedded fonts.
- I thought it was either PostScript Level 2 or PostScript with level 2
- font support, but I wasn't able to find the reference (I looked in the
- NeWSPrint 2.0 release notes). In any case NeWSPrint 2.0 now supports
- this. I hope you're using NeWSPrint, especially since you work at
- Sun!!! -- If so, upgrade and go!!
-
- I haven't looked into the possibility of upgrading the Tektronix, I
- doubt it's possible. Perhaps someone knows the correct name for this
- PostScript functionality?
